Male Anatomy vs. Women's Anatomy

What's the Difference?

Male anatomy and women's anatomy have many similarities, such as both having reproductive organs and skeletal structures. However, there are also significant differences between the two. For example, men typically have larger muscle mass and bone density, while women have a higher percentage of body fat and a wider pelvis to accommodate childbirth. Additionally, men have a prostate gland and women have breasts and a uterus. Overall, while both male and female anatomy share common features, they also have unique characteristics that distinguish them from one another.

Physical Differences

One of the most obvious differences between male and female anatomy is the reproductive organs. Males have external genitalia, including the penis and testes, while females have internal reproductive organs, such as the ovaries, fallopian tubes, and uterus. Additionally, males typically have more muscle mass and a higher percentage of body hair compared to females. Women, on the other hand, tend to have a higher percentage of body fat and wider hips to accommodate childbirth.

Hormonal Variances

Another key difference between male and female anatomy is the hormonal makeup. Males produce higher levels of testosterone, which is responsible for traits such as increased muscle mass, facial hair growth, and a deeper voice. Females, on the other hand, have higher levels of estrogen and progesterone, which regulate the menstrual cycle, pregnancy, and other female-specific functions. These hormonal differences can also impact behavior and emotional responses in men and women.

Reproductive Functions

When it comes to reproduction, males and females have distinct roles. Males produce sperm in the testes, which are then ejaculated during intercourse to fertilize a female's egg. Females, on the other hand, release eggs from the ovaries each month during ovulation, which can be fertilized by sperm to create a zygote. The female body also undergoes significant changes during pregnancy to support the growth and development of the fetus, including hormonal shifts and physical adaptations.

Sexual Characteristics

Sexual characteristics play a significant role in distinguishing between male and female anatomy. In males, secondary sexual characteristics include facial hair, a deeper voice, and increased muscle mass. In females, secondary sexual characteristics include breast development, wider hips, and the growth of pubic hair. These characteristics develop during puberty under the influence of sex hormones and help differentiate between the two sexes.

Health Considerations

There are also health considerations that differ between male and female anatomy. For example, men are more prone to certain health conditions such as heart disease and prostate cancer, while women are at a higher risk for conditions like breast cancer and osteoporosis. Additionally, reproductive health issues such as menstrual disorders and infertility can affect women, while men may face concerns related to erectile dysfunction and infertility.
